The project engages with the altered air, that emanates from energy intensive activities concentrated in/around cities, impacting environments and inhabitants unevenly and disproportionately within/beyond their boundaries. It addresses the questions of air’s governability, and the role of imaginaries in navigating the invisibility of scientific infrastructures and governance by numbers. Building upon fieldwork in Beijing it produces bidirectional exchanges between sciences and arts.
